According to our LPI (LP Information) latest study, the global Perfluoroelastomer (FFKM) market size was valued at US$ 387.4 million in 2023. With growing demand in downstream market, the Perfluoroelastomer (FFKM) is forecast to a readjusted size of US$ 460.2 million by 2030 with a CAGR of 2.5% during review period.

Perfluoroelastomer (FFKM) offer the highest operating temperature range, the most comprehensive chemical compatibility and the lowest off-gassing and extractable levels of any rubber material. They are capable of service temperatures up to 327°C, and are resistant to more than 1,800 chemical substances. It is widely used in petroleum & chemical industry, aerospace industry, Chemical & Materials industry, etc. This report studies the FFKM polymer market.
Global Perfluoroelastomer (FFKM) key players include DuPont, Solvay, 3M, Daikin, Asahi Glass, etc. Global top five manufacturers hold a share about 95%. North America is the largest market, with a share about 40%, followed by Asia-Pacific, with a share about 30 percent. In terms of product, O-rings is the largest segment, with a share about 50%. And in terms of application, the largest application is Aerospace Industry, followed by Petroleum & Chemical Industry, and Semiconductor Industry, etc.
